Buying a Vacuum Mop Cleaner Robot
The majority of robot mops require cleaning products that are specific to the brand. These can be purchased directly from the manufacturer. It is crucial to use the recommended cleaning solution, because a DIY cleaner could cause damage to internal hardware and invalidate the warranty.
Many models come with a separate application to save your home's map as well as set cleaning schedules and monitor the accessories like brushes for wear. Certain models, Robot Mop And Vacuum Combo such as the DEEBOT X1 OMNI have developed features that go beyond mopping and cleaning.
Smart Cleaning
When cleaning is involved, a vacuum mop cleaner robot can offer you many benefits. They can clean your floors on a regular schedule and can be controlled from any place in the world. They can also detect obstacles and take them out of the way. Some are equipped with advanced navigation capabilities that can assist them in navigating around your home.
The most recent models on the market are designed to be mop cleaners with smart technology that can perform both sweeping and vacuuming. They have dual-purpose dust bins that can hold dirt as well as damp mop pads. They are easy to operate and maintain. The app allows you to create a cleaning schedule, change the water level and monitor the status of the machine. Certain models also come with built-in sensors to help them detect and avoid furniture.
The majority of the latest models we've tested are smart mop cleaner robots that connect to your Wi-Fi network and communicate with you through an app. Some models can save floor maps and can work with voice assistants such as Amazon Alexa or Google. Some robots come with a rechargeable power source that can run the robot for three hours. This is perfect for large homes.
The majority of smart mop cleaner robots we have tested are simple to install and use. It takes longer to remove packaging and follow the directions before you download the app and then set up the robot. Some models, such as the Yeedi Vac Max, come with a QR code that is placed on the box to make the setup process much easier. The majority of new robots have docking stations that self-empties and needs to be emptied every 30 days.
The new Narwhal Freo robot is an example of a robot that is both convenient and intelligent. After a simple mapping process, you can control it via the app on your tablet or smartphone. It can map a variety of areas and distinguish the type of floor that you want to mark to sweep or mop & vacuum in one. It can also be programmed to use disposable or reusable pads. It also comes with detection of objects and can be programmed to clean on a regular basis or in response to an alarm. It also has a programmable spot mode that targets specific areas for a more thorough cleaning.
Easy to operate
The majority of robotic mops are connected to Wi-Fi and they come with an app. This allows you to save maps of your house as well as organize cleaning schedules, modify mopping modes, and track the actions of your device while it's in use. Also, look for models that offer smart home integration, which means you can make use of them with voice assistants such as Alexa or Google Assistant. You'll need to decide if you want a robot which can do dry sweeping and mopping wet or simply vacuums. Certain mops will require the pads that are reusable are manually wetted prior to use and then cleaned after each use (as they will need to be emptied of dirty liquid, if applicable).
Many other models offer amazing features that are worth a look. Eufy X8 Hybrid allows you to switch between vacuuming and mopping by pressing a single button in its app. The two mop heads that rotate have more scrubbing force than the flat cloths that is used by the majority of models. It also cleaned up dried-up coffee, ketchup, and other stubborn staining materials better than other robot mop. It also has a very low level of noise, which means it can be used during the day without causing disruption to your work or household.
It is also important to consider the length of time the robot will run on a single battery charge and the size of its water tank, and whether it can adjust the amount it uses for mopping with water. It's important to choose an automatic mop that can move between hardwood floors and carpets when you live in a house that has both. It is helpful if the robot can recognize and avoid furniture, area rugs, and other small items that could be lying on the floor.
Most robot mops come with an auto-cleaning feature that cleans the docking station and base. Find a model that also has an user-friendly touchscreen or remote control so you can easily alter settings. Make sure you download any software updates that your model might offer via its app, as these could improve navigation and identification capabilities.
Easy to Store
Similar to vacuum cleaners mopping machines are large and bulky, making them hard to fit in narrow spaces or under furniture. Many are rechargeable, but they also require being plugged into an outlet that is powered by electricity or turned on while in use. You should consider a handheld or cordless model if you are short in space and want a small, compact mop.
Unlike traditional vacuum cleaners, that typically come with brushes or suction that trap dirt inside the filtration system, a mop uses water to eliminate it from floors. It is gentler on carpets and floors than a vacuum cleaner however, it leaves a damp residue that must be wiped down. Some models come with disposable cleaning pads or disposable pads. Reusable pads are more sustainable but requires washing after each use.
Check the instruction manual for your mop before using any cleaning solution. Many manufacturers only recommend specific brands of cleaner, and using other types of liquid can damage or void your warranty.
The most effective robot mops have rotating heads which lift food items and other debris stuck to the floor. They have cleaning modes that scrub the floor with more scrubbing to get rid of staining that is difficult to remove. The SpinWave, for instance, was able to remove a dried mud stain in only two passes through its cleaning process and was much faster than other mops we tested.
Some models include a tank of clean and dirty water that is automatically empty the mop pads, and washes them after every cleaning. This feature can save time and effort by removing the necessity of washing and emptying the pads manually. This feature is included on the more recent Ecovacs Roborock S7 maxV ultra and Deebot OmniX1 models.
If you're looking for a robotic mop with a vacuum and mops, choose one with an automatic emptyer. These mops have a larger dirt bin than the ones that aren't automated and can accommodate more debris without overflowing. They also have a smarter navigation system to help them avoid obstacles and keep their path free of obstructions. However, they could be stuck on small objects like an USB cord or socks, and be lost in rooms filled with furniture.
Easy to carry
If you're looking at a mop/vac robot, choose one that has a battery that is removable. This makes it lighter and easier to move from room to room. It's a great option for busy families. Think about the dimensions of the tank and whether you can use different cleaning products for each task. If you're using a model that utilizes disposable or reusable mopping pads ensure that they can be easily removed and washed after each use. Mopping robots may trap large amounts of moisture under the device. Additionally, if the pads or cloths remain wet for long periods of time, they may develop mildew or bacteria.
Another important thing to keep in mind is the size of the robot itself. The majority of robot mops don't have the same size as a vacuum, but this doesn't mean that they aren't difficult to maneuver. You'll need to examine the model you pick to ensure it can reach corners and under furniture easily. It's worth noting that many robot mop-vacs are loud when in use, which may be a problem for some households.
Modern robot vacuums and mops are able to be controlled through an app. This is especially applicable to more sophisticated models, which can map your home and save maps on memory. These apps can be used to design a cleaning schedule and then choose mowing or vacuuming modes. They can also be used to track your robot's health and inform you when it's time for maintenance, such as a filter change.
If you're looking for a basic and affordable mop-vac robot mop and vacuum Combo, take a look at the Eufy X8 Hybrid. This model is easy to set up and it comes with a simple control device to operate. Its low-noise rating allows you to use it all day long. It also does a good job of navigating corners and under furniture. This model also has excellent anti-stuffing capabilities and can be used on various types of flooring including tile and hardwood.
